Image: Thinkstock You can't see or touch tension, however you can feel its effects on your mind and body. In the short term, tension accelerates your heart rate and breathing and increases your blood pressure.

Though you may not have the ability to eliminate the roots of tension, you can lessen its results on your body. One of the simplest and most attainable stress-relieving strategies is meditation, a program in which you focus your attention inward to cause a state of deep relaxation. Although the practice of meditation is thousands of years old, research study on its health benefits is fairly brand-new, but promising.

Studies have shown that practicing meditation regularly can assist eliminate signs in individuals who suffer from chronic pain, but the neural mechanisms underlying the relief were unclear. April 21 in the journal Brain Research Publication, the scientists found that people trained to meditate over an eight-week duration were much better able to control a particular type of brain waves called alpha rhythms.

" Our information indicate that meditation training makes you much better at focusing, in part by allowing you to much better manage how things that arise will impact you." There are several different types of brain waves that assist manage the circulation of details in between brain cells, comparable to the method that radio stations relayed at particular frequencies.

The alpha waves help reduce unimportant or distracting sensory details. A 1966 research study showed that a group of Buddhist monks who practiced meditation routinely had elevated alpha rhythms throughout their brains. In the new research study, the researchers concentrated on the waves' role in a specific part of the brain cells of the sensory cortex that procedure tactile info from the hands and feet.



Half of the individuals were trained in a technique called mindfulness-based tension decrease (MBSR) over an eight-week period, while the other half were informed not to practice meditation. The MBSR program calls for individuals to meditate for 45 minutes each day, after an initial two-and-a-half-hour training session - https://sitereport.netcraft.com/?url=https://spiritualsync.com. The topics listen to a CD recording that guides them through the sessions
